Japanese game industry see sizable boost for first 6 months of 2017 thanks to Switch

- domestic market for video game hardware and software combined in the first half of 2017 reached US$1.35 billion
- Hardware sales: 76.51 billion yen (+44% year-on-year)
- Software sales: 76.69 billion yen (-4.6%)
- Total: 153.2 billion yen (+14.8%)
- this is the first increase in three years in Japan’s console market (when considering the first six months in a year)
- the three months the Switch contributed to the industry were apparently enough to turn a very likely minus into a plus

Hardware Ranking For 6 First Months Of 2017

Nintendo Switch: 1,016,473 million units sold
Sony PS4: 877,630 (now at 4,799,246 total)
Nintendo DS: 872,620 (22,784,033)
Sony PS Vita: 260,296 (5,507,715)
Microsoft XBox One: 5,093 (78,041)

Software Ranking For 6 First Months Of 2017

Monster Hunter XX for 3DS (1,640,005 units sold)
Pokemon Sun and Moon for 3DS (527,862)
Mario Kart 8 Deluxe for Switch (501, 614)
Zelda Breath Of The Wild for Switch (464,480)
Super Mario Maker for 3DS (397,656)
Biohazard 7 for PS4 (324,066)
NieR: Automata for PS4 (311,906)
Momotaro Dentetsu 2017 Tachiagare Nippon!! for 3DS (263,790)
Yokai Watch Sukiyaki for 3DS (215,297)
1-2 Switch for Switch (200,807)
